A Flow Hood for Mushrooms is the heartbeat of any cultivation facility. It ensures that the delicate process of agar work, liquid culture inoculation, and grain spawn transfer occurs in a 100% sterile environment, free from airborne contaminants like mold spores and bacteria.
Today, the industry is witnessing a shift toward energy-efficient EC fans and H14 HEPA filters that offer 99.995% efficiency. Modern growers are moving away from DIY "Still Air Boxes" (SAB) to professional Laminar Flow Clean Benches. This trend is driven by the need for higher success rates in commercial cloning.
Newer flow hood designs are incorporating smart sensors to monitor filter pressure drop, ensuring the laminar flow velocity remains at the optimal 0.45 m/s.

For mushroom cultivation, the difference between an H13 and an H14 filter can be the difference between a successful harvest and a total loss. H14 HEPA filters are tested to ensure they capture 99.995% of particles at 0.3 microns. Since most competitive molds and bacteria are within the 0.5 to 5-micron range, the H14 provides a critical safety buffer.
Our flow hoods are designed with a two-stage filtration system. By using our G4 Cardboard Pleated Pre-Filters, you can extend the life of your expensive HEPA filter by up to 24 months. The pre-filter catches the large dust and debris, allowing the HEPA to focus purely on microscopic spores.
